增施硅肥对水稻抗稻瘟病的效果分析

摘    要:目的]为硅肥在防治水稻稻瘟病中的应用提供理论依据。方法]通过硅肥对水稻稻瘟病的防治试验研究不同处理中水稻剑叶叶倾角、叶面硅的微域分布及其抗病相关酶的活性。结果]在抽穗期,施硅处理的发病率和病情指数分别比不施硅处理下降8.9个百分点和3.4,其相对防治效果达27.64%;不施硅处理的剑叶叶倾角为16°,施硅处理的剑叶叶倾角显著小于不施硅处理,其差值为9°。施硅处理的健康叶片的哑铃状硅化细胞、乳突及其他表面部位的硅含量均高于不施硅处理,接茵后第5天,施硅处理叶片的硅化细胞、乳突及其他表面部位的硅含量有所上升,不施硅处理的明显下降。施硅推迟了POD和CAT对接种稻瘟病茵的响应时间,接种稻瘟病菌后施硅处理的SOD自我调节能力强于不施硅处理。结论]在水稻生产中,展叶期之后硅仍能明显增强水稻对稻瘟病的抗性。

关 键 词:  水稻  稻瘟病菌  硅化细胞  抗病性
